First Aid Program for Children and Infants
The First Aid program for children and infants is aimed at individuals and professionals working with children. It complies with the specifications of the Children’s Skills Teaching Council (Ofsted GB) and includes training in Basic Life Support (CPR) and First Aid. Additionally, there is an option to learn the Automated External Defibrillator (AED) for children.
Participants are prepared to recognize a variety of incidents, whether they pose a threat to a child’s or infant’s life. The training focuses equally on Basic Life Support (CPR) and First Aid (handling common illnesses and injuries) for both age groups.

WHO IS IT FOR?
Each person who wants to know all the valid techniques in order to respond properly to a child or infant emergency. It is also appropriate choice for nurseries, child minders, parents, teachers, trainers, health care professionals
This program is ideal for anyone wanting to learn emergency response techniques for children and infants, including nursery teachers, parents, teachers, child care staff, academy coaches, and healthcare professionals.
